4D Internet Commands v16

IT_Encode

Inicio

 
4D Internet Commands v16
IT_Encode

IT_Encode 


 

IT_Encode ( nomArchivo ; nomArchivoCod ; modoCod ) -> resultado 
Parámetro Tipo   Descripción
nomArchivo  Texto in Ruta de acceso local a un archivo
nomArchivoCod  Texto in Ruta de acceso del archivo codificado
in Ruta de acceso al archivo codificado resultante
modoCod  Entero in 1 = BinHex 2 = Base64 (Data fork only) 3 = AppleSingle 4 = AppleDouble 5 = AppleSingle Y Base64 6 = AppleDouble Y Base64 7 = UUEncode 8 = MacBinary
resultado  Entero in Código de error

El comando IT_Encode codifica un archivo utilizando el encodeMode especificado. El archivo especificado no se modificará y se crea una copia codificada. El nombre del archivo codificado creado será el nombre del archivo original más un sufijo para especificar el método de codificación. Para la codificación BinHex, se añadirá el sufijo ".hqx". Para la codificación Base64, se añadirá el sufijo ".b64". Para la codificación AppleSingle, se añadirá el sufijo ".as".

nomArchivo  contiene la ruta de acceso completa del archivo a codificar. Si pasa una cadena vacía en este parámetro, aparece una caja de diálogo para seleccionar un archivo.

nomArchivoCode puede contener:

  • La ruta de acceso completa de la copia codificada del archivo, lo que permite definir el nombre y la ubicación.
  • La ruta completa de acceso de la carpeta que va a recibir el archivo codificado (sin especificar el nombre del archivo); el nombre del archivo será el nombre del archivo original con un sufijo para especificar el método de codificación.
  • Una cadena vacía (en este caso, el comando IT_Encode) asigna un nombre para el documento, que se ubica en la misma carpeta que el archivo especificado en el primer parámetro. Si se especifica o no, la ruta completa del documento codificado se devolverá en este parámetro. Debido a la posibilidad de posibles conflictos de nombres en el directorio especificado, se recomienda basarse en el valor resultante del parámetro.

modoCode define el método de codificación a aplicar al archivo. El valor por defecto es 1 para la codificación BinHex. Otros métodos son los siguientes:

CódigoMétodo
1BinHex
2Base64 (Data fork únicamente)
3AppleSingle
4AppleDouble
5AppleSingle y Base64
6AppleDouble y Base64
7UUEncode
8MacBinary

Para la codificación utilizando AppleDouble (modos de codificación 4 y 6), se crean dos archivos llamados "%nomArchivo" y "nomArchivo".



Ver también 

IT_Decode

 
PROPIEDADES 

Producto: 4D Internet Commands
Tema: IC Utilities
Número 88910

 
HISTORIA 

Modificado: 4D Internet Commands 6.8.1

 
ARTICLE USAGE

4D Internet Commands ( 4D Internet Commands v16)